Abstract :
Transient electromagnetic (EM) emissions are generated
when thyristor or gate turn-off thyristor (GTO) valves
are being switched on and off within substations installed with
static var compensators (SVCs) and static synchronous compensators
(STATCOMs). These emissions may cause malfunction of,
or damage to, electronic equipment positioned nearby without
appropriate protection. Four SVC-based substations and one
STATCOM-based substation were selected for electromagneticinterference
(EMI) measurement, analysis, and evaluation. A
comparison was made between the radiated EMI features from
each. The analyzed results were correlated to the present electromagnetic-
compatibility standards, and recommendations of
changes for immunity tests were presented specifically for flexible
ac transmission system (FACTS)-based radiated EMI. Preliminary
analysis was also given to the causes of FACTS-based EMI,
which indicated that valve switching behavior and the stray parameters
of FACTS equipment layout were the main contributors
to high-frequency-radiated interference.
